At the end of December 2018 I installed the latest firmware update and started experiencing the following issues:
1) Sync with phone via Bluetooth works for about 10-30 minutes after pairing, then fails. Connection never seems to recover, or does so randomly, with no discernible schedule or pattern, then fails again.
Experienced the issue on iPad, Galaxy S9+ and MS Lumia 950XL, all 3 of which worked perfectly with the previous Firmware version.
2) Bluetooth detection with other hardware (PC, phone) without using the app stops working. The Ionic is no longer visible.
3) Battery life went down from about 72h to less than 24h, I once experienced a sudden drop from 75% to 25% in the span of 1 minute.
4) Ionic's internal clock becomes unreliable, losing about 3-5 minutes per hour.
None of this was true with the previous firmware.
What I tried:
* Soft reset (left + bottom right button for 10s). No improvement.
* Unpairing the Ionic and performing factory reset four(4) times. No improvement.
* Uninstalling and reinstalling the app. No improvement.
Watch information:
M/N FB503
Language: French
Version: 27.33.1.30
Available memory: 2 554 Mb
The watch is 100% vanilla. No extras installed, no 3rd party animated clock face, no music via Bluetooth.
I do not swim with it, clean it up regularly, and only use the included charger cable.
Observation: this seems to be a widespread issue since others have reported similar issues in the [Fitbit OS 3.0 - Ionic Firmware Release (27.33.1.30)] forum.
I strongly suspect some severe software bugs in the 27.33.1.30 firmware update, given that these are all new issues introduced after the update.
